Configuration
-------------
@ -69,11 +69,14 @@ If _-c_ is not specified, sway will look in several locations for your config
file. The suggested location for your config file is ~/.config/sway/config.
~/.sway/config will also work, and the rest of the usual XDG config locations
are supported. If no sway config is found, sway will attempt to load an i3
config from all the config locations i3 supports. At last, sway looks for a
config file in a fallback directory, which is /etc/sway/ by default. A standard
config from all the config locations i3 supports. Sway looks for a config file in
a fallback directory as a last resort, which is /etc/sway/ by default. A standard
configuration file is installed at this location. If still nothing is found,
you will receive an error.
To write your own config, it's suggested that you copy the default config file to
the location of your choosing and start there.
For information on the config file format, see **sway**(5).

**floating_modifier** <modifier> [normal|inverse]::
When the _modifier_ key is held down, you may use left click to drag floating
When the _modifier_ key is held down, you may hold left click to move floating
windows, and right click to resize them. Unlike i3, this modifier may also be
used to resize and move windows that are tiled. With the _inverse_ mode
enabled, left click is used for resizing and right click for dragging. The
mode paramenter is optional and defaults to _normal_ if it isn't defined.
**floating_scroll** <up|down|left|right> [command]::
Sets the command to be executed on scrolling in the specified
direction while holding the floating modifier. Resets the
command, when given no arguments.
Sets a command to be executed when the mouse wheel is scrolled in the
specified direction while holding the floating modifier. Resets the command,
when given no arguments.
**focus_follows_mouse** <yes|no>::
If set to _yes_, the currently focused view will change as you move your
mouse around the screen to the view that ends up underneath your mouse.
If set to _yes_, moving your mouse over a window will focus that window.
